'll VTJHVS - J HAMBURGER FANCY EASTERN — Pc und ri ir» SLICED BACON 4ac W HITE STAR - Bite Size ’/a Can J E ït '■ NÏT-. ■ • • W 'W ft* &■ J-.t 2 ftr CAMPBELLS — 4» ' ■ K ■ M «ÖS TOMATO SOUP af H O LID A Y M .. *- .•y •. .-y MMM Oleo Invest in Dependability... get a Bonus in G o/ You can buy it on its name alone— this big, high-powered ’56 Pontiac— and be safe in the knowledge that you couldn’t have made a better investment in years of dependable, carefree motoring. The good things you’ve been hear ing about Pontiac for years assure you that. But "go" is the word for '56! Per formance so new and dramatic it must be experienced to be believed! A short spell behind the wheel will nail that statement down as a fact. Come along for a drive and see. Waiting for the light to change, you can’t hear the engine. But touch your toe to the accelerator and in a split second there’s a torrent of power, sparked by the most advanced engine of them all—the blazing 227- h.p. Strato-Streak V-8. Team this terrific power plant with Pontiac’s all-new Strato-Flight Hydra-Matic* and you’ve got the smoothest take-off that ever bright ened a highway. And remember —this easy han dling dream is actually among the biggest, huskiest cars built! Now for the final test—head foi the open road and some landmarks you can challenge. Wipe out a hilL Straighten a curve. Smooth out a stretch of rough road that's bothered you for years. Now see why they’re calling this the greatest ‘’go” on wheels? More than that — it's the greatest buy on wheels! And that too, is easy to prove. rhen take a look at the price tag— a check on our deal.
